在Ubuntu下重置Mysql密码的步骤如下:查看配置文件:执行命令cat /etc/mysql/debian.cnf,以获取MySQL的默认用户和密码等信息。登录MySQL:使用从配置文件中获取的用户和密码登录MySQL,进入mysql数据库。mysql库管理着MySQL的系统和用户权限信息。更新root用户密码:执行SQL语句update mysql.user set authenticat...
Ubuntu重置Mysql密码
在Ubuntu下重置Mysql密码的步骤如下:
查看配置文件:
执行命令cat /etc/mysql/debian.cnf,以获取MySQL的默认用户和密码等信息。登录MySQL:
使用从配置文件中获取的用户和密码登录MySQL,进入mysql数据库。mysql库管理着MySQL的系统和用户权限信息。更新root用户密码:
执行SQL语句update mysql.user set authentication_string=password where user='root' and Host='localhost';,将新密码替换为你想要设置的新密码,例如123456。修改plugin类型:
为确保使用安全的密码存储方式,执行命令update mysql.user set plugin='mysql_native_password' where user='root' and Host='localhost';。重新加载权限:
执行flush privileges;命令,以更新并生效新的权限设置。注意:以上操作为简化版本,具体步骤和参数可能因MySQL版本和Ubuntu环境差异有所变化。在实际操作中,需要根据实际情况调整命令参数。同时,请确保在重置密码前已备份相关数据,以防数据丢失。
2025-05-08